Asheville Falls in Series Opener at ETSU
02.26.2021 | Baseball
JOHNSON CITY, Tenn. – The UNC Asheville baseball team suffered its first loss of the 2021 season Friday evening as it fell at East Tennessee State by a score of 9-1. The defeat moves Asheville's record to 1-1 on the young season.
After two scoreless innings to begin the game, Asheville struck first in the third as a groundout by Dominic Freeberger plated Drew Bristow to give the Bulldogs a 1-0 lead. However, ETSU quickly tied the game in the bottom half of the inning. The Buccaneers then hit a solo home run in the fourth, tacked on three in the fifth, and scored four more in the seventh to run away from the Bulldogs, 9-1.
Offensively, the Bulldogs totaled four hits and drew two walks against the ETSU pitching staff. Ty Kaufman continued his hot start offensively to begin his collegiate career going 2-for-3 with a pair of singles to boost his batting average to .714 through two games. Chris Troost picked up a single, and Freeberger not only drove in Asheville's lone run of the game but also notched its only extra-base hit of the contest with a double in the sixth.
Junior Jacob Edwards made his second consecutive start on the mound for Asheville and ended up taking the loss. Edwards, whose record moves to 1-1, worked the game's first five innings, allowing five runs (four earned) on five hits to go with three strikeouts.
Following Edwards' departure, Trey Jernigan, Bryce Fisher, Ryan Stalker made their 2021 debuts. Jernigan picked up three strikeouts in his outing but ran into some trouble during his second inning with an error, two walks, and a two-run double. This led to Fisher being called upon. Fisher walked three in his collegiate debut but got Asheville out of the inning with just one more run allowed. Finally, Stalker was very efficient during the eighth inning. The Wycombe, Pennsylvania native struck out a pair of ETSU hitters and delivered nine strikes on 10 pitches thrown in the eighth.
The same two teams will meet again Saturday for a doubleheader in Johnson City. First pitch of the twin bill is scheduled for 2 p.m.
